Foreign exchange reserves: US$405.194 (May 2013) Taiwan's foreign exchange holdings are the 4th-largest in the world, ranking behind only those of mainland China, Japan and Russia.
GDP (Gross domestic product): US$474.3 billion
GDP per capita : US$20,386
GNP(Gross national product): US$489.5 billion
GNP per capita: US$21,042
Unemployment rate:4.24%
Saving rate: Taiwan 28.16%, United States 12.6%, Germany 23.46%
Total trade: US$ 571.6 billion
Total exports: US$ 301.2 billion
Total imports: US$270.50 billion
Top three trading partners (by volume): Mainland China (including Hong Kong and Macau, US$ 162.4 billion, 28.4%), ASEAN-10(US$88.1 billion, 15.4%), Japan (US$66.56 billion, 11.6%)
Taiwan is the world's 27th-largest economic entity.
World Trade Organization statistics show Taiwan as the world's 17th-largest exporter and 18th-largest importer.
Composition of GDP: Agriculture 1.90% Industry 28.95% Service 69.15%
